As a Payroll Manager for [Via Germany,]( you'll own the end-to-end payroll process for 900+ hourly employees across the region - keeping one of the most critical parts of our business running smoothly, accurately, and compliantly. As we continue to scale across Europe, you'll work closely with our Finance, People, and Operations teams to strengthen payroll processes and ensure our teams are paid reliably and on time, every month.
What You’ll Do- Own and drive the monthly payroll process for Via Germany - partnering closely with our external payroll provider and internal Finance, People, and Operations teams to ensure accurate, timely execution every month.
- Monitor changes in German tax regulations, wage laws, and compliance requirements, making sure our processes stay aligned with evolving regulatory standards.
- Perform regular payroll audits to maintain the accuracy and integrity of employee pay data, and proactively design and implement process improvements and internal controls.
- Manage benefit deductions and tax withholdings, ensuring calculations and reporting are precise, compliant, and handled with the highest confidentiality.
- Lead payroll-related financial reporting - from preparing journal entries to reconciling general ledger accounts.
- Support on escalated payroll queries that the Support Operations team can't resolve independently.
- Contribute to cross-functional projects and operational improvements that strengthen payroll processes and support the broader Finance team.
- You bring 5+ years of payroll experience in Germany, including with hourly/shift-based employees, with a strong grasp of local regulations and tax requirements.
- You're comfortable working with HRIS and payroll systems such as P&I Loga, and highly proficient in Microsoft Excel.
- You work with precision and ownership - detail-oriented, reliable, and able to meet strict deadlines independently.
- You communicate clearly and collaborate effectively across Finance, People, and other internal teams.
- You're proactive and process-driven, always looking for ways to improve workflows and make things run more smoothly.
- Fluency in English and German is required.
